6029456 Henry Pelham, British Whig politician and Prime Minister (engraving) by English School, (19th century); Private Collection; (add.info.: Henry Pelham (1694-1754), British Whig politician and Prime Minister. Illustration from Memoires of the Last Ten Years of the Reign of King George the Second, Volume I, by Horace Walpole, Earl of Orford (John Murray, London, 1822).); Look and Learn / Elgar Collection

This engraving showcases Henry Pelham, a prominent British Whig politician and Prime Minister of the 18th century. The detailed portrait captures his dignified presence and offers a glimpse into the political landscape of that era. Created by an English School artist in the 19th century, this print is part of a private collection. Henry Pelham (1694-1754) played a significant role in British politics during the reign of King George II. This illustration is taken from "Memoires of the Last Ten Years of the Reign of King George the Second" written by Horace Walpole, Earl of Orford and published in London in 1822.
